Transaction

89c8a0925731df6e3b1904d47ed103e76e66bc755c2b72eab2cc4d75f58556d1

Summary

In Block667185
TimeTue, 23 Apr 2024 06:28:15 UTC
Total Input34 Nebula
Total Output68 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
24573 Confirmations68 Nebula
Raw Transaction